NeonAstronaut Dark Appalachian folk collides with trip-hop, industrial, Southern gothic, and just about any other genre you can think of. Banjos echo through broken beat loops, old ghost stories drift beneath dark Ozark skies, and deep baritone vocals—though not always Southern, or even male—tell tales of love, loss, redemption, monsters, murder, faith, addiction, and the things that haunt us long after the sun comes up. Every song is a different road through the same wilderness—raw, cinematic, and emotionally honest. No genre is off limits. No topic is too taboo. If the story demands bluegrass, metal, rap, ambient, darkwave, pop, or folk, that's where the journey goes. Welcome to my mountain range. Welcome to NeonAstronaut.
